In March 2021, Gary Lefreniere launched A Place At Home in North Chelmsford, MA, bringing a mission-driven senior care franchise to the community he’s always called home. Backed by more than 20 years of leadership experience, Gary now leads a dedicated team of 50 employees committed to providing compassionate, professional care to local families. He was drawn to A Place At Home for its comprehensive training, strong corporate support, and values that mirror his own.
Offering a full continuum of senior care services, including in-home care, care coordination, staffing, and senior living placement, Gary’s growing business is a reflection of both the strength of the franchise model and his deep-rooted passion for service. In a few sentences, please tell us a little about yourself!
I’m a lifelong Chelmsford resident, and my wife and I have proudly raised our family here. Because of this, opening A Place At Home in our hometown felt like a natural next step. Before launching this senior care franchise, I spent 20 years as the co-founder and Chief Operating Officer of a data storage software company.
What made you decide to look into purchasing a franchise?
Having been a co-founder in my previous career, I was already familiar with the demands of running a business. At this stage in my life, I knew I didn’t want to work for anyone but my clients. Owning my own company was the only path forward, and partnering with a senior care franchise like A Place At Home offered the operational and marketing support I needed to succeed.
How does the franchisor support and encourage your success?
A Place At Home corporate does an amazing job supporting its franchisees. Constant training, coaching, support, and marketing are always available. There are weekly webinars, round-tables, and coaching sessions available to all owners.
What are you most proud of and why?
As a senior care services provider, what we’re most proud of is our reputation within the community. Many of the inquiries we receive now come purely through word of mouth. We get a lot of referrals from local families we’ve had the privilege to support. These are the most meaningful leads because they don’t come from advertising, but from the trust and appreciation of those we’ve helped. There’s no greater compliment than someone sharing their positive experience with others.
What advice would you give to new or potential franchise buyers?
Take the time to thoroughly research the franchise’s corporate leadership—the individuals shaping the vision and direction of the brand. If their values and goals don’t align with yours, it’s likely not the right fit. Strong leadership sets the tone for the entire organization, so it’s important that you trust and believe in the people at the top.
Most importantly, make sure you’re genuinely passionate about the work. True success and fulfillment come when you care deeply about what you’re doing—beyond just the financial rewards.
